| Riverside Golf and Country Club Began in 1863 when John White from Scotland began golfing on the sand flats of Courtney Bay at low tide. Moved to East Riverside in 1913. Curling was added in 1966. |
| Ice Skating/Speed Skating James
A. Whelpley from Kings County invented the "Long Reach Speed Skate"
and introduced it on the Long Reach about 1870. After that skating became
a passion for young and old alike. Many practiced
skating on the wide stretches of the Kennebecasis. During the winter months travel by ice back and forth to the Pennisula was very common. Ice skates made the trip much faster and easier. |
